带有uuencode的mailx是否安全,如果不是安全的方式

时间:2017-01-02 08:09:49

标签: unix scripting ksh

使用uuencode和mailx在unix中发送电子邮件是安全的吗? 我发送邮件与csv附件如下

<html>

<head>
  <link href="style.css" rel="stylesheet">
  <title>Open Cube</title>
  <h1>Apertura Cubo</h1>
</head>

<body>
  <div class="sk-folding-cube">
    <div class="sk-cube1 sk-cube"></div>
    <div class="sk-cube2 sk-cube"></div>
    <div class="sk-cube4 sk-cube"></div>
    <div class="sk-cube3 sk-cube"></div>
    <div class="sk-cube5 sk-cube"></div>
    <div class="sk-cube6 sk-cube"></div>
  </div>
</body>

</html>

如果没有保障,请建议安全的方式。

1 个答案:

答案 0 :(得分:1)

要通过电子邮件安全地发送数据,以确保只有收件人才能读取内容,您需要加密数据。

有几种工具可用于此,但uuencode不是其中之一,因为任何拥有uudecode命令的人都可以解码编码内容。

就个人而言,我使用GnuPG,它可以通过使用收件人的公共GnuPG密钥或使用对称密码来加密脚本中的文件。

这是加密的GnuPG消息(使用gpg2 --symmetric --armour创建)的示例:

-----BEGIN PGP MESSAGE-----                                     

jA0EBwMCyfiq33FFUExg0lEBx/7bIHVdo3B4eHB5HYMJLmNpv8SM8j+rW7et65l3
DiTZIRxhhdQMfdKcMyhGUb1i9auvhX9Myzt94LIxjqLBxhh0vC/BlMhEOzyKh2bS
NjI=                                                            
=hrtj                                                           
-----END PGP MESSAGE-----                  

gpg2 --decrypt解密。顺便说一下,密码是hello